      <description>&lt;P&gt;We have a client that connected to Splunk Deployment server where we get an error "DC:DeploymentClient - channel=tenantService/handshake Will retry sending handshake message to DS; err=not_connected". Ping and telnet to the Deployment server works fine and when we try to add some data into splunk its not getting indexed due to the above error. Is there any possible solutions available for this scenario?&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;I read a lot of comments about the error  &lt;CODE&gt;DC:DeploymentClient - channel=tenantService/handshake Will retry sending handshake message to DS; err=not_connected&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;To summarize what I found out:&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;UL&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;This error is about the connection between DC and DS, so it doesn't affect the possibility of your forwarder to upload the logs. But if there's a problem with DC - DS communication your DC can be unable to deploy apps to your forwarders (like &lt;CODE&gt;outputs&lt;/CODE&gt; or &lt;CODE&gt;inputs&lt;/CODE&gt;), so your forwarder doesn't know where to take logs and where to forward.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;/UL&gt;

&lt;P&gt;What you can check on forwarder:&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;OL&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;Is your DS uri set properly: &lt;CODE&gt;$SPLUNK_HOME/bin/splunk show deploy-poll&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;Is there a network connection between DC and DS. For example using &lt;CODE&gt;telnet &amp;lt;DS-uri&amp;gt; 8089&lt;/CODE&gt; (if you didn't change management port)&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;Is your forwarder showing on DS in clients tab and when it phoned home for the last time.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;Did your forwarder get the apps from DS. They shoud be located in directories like this: &lt;CODE&gt;$SPLUNK_HOME/etc/apps/&amp;lt;your_app_name&amp;gt;/local/&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;The version of Splunk forwarder.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;/OL&gt;

&lt;P&gt;In my case my forwarder wasn't showing on DS in clients tab, but the DS uri was correct. And there were no problems with the network connectivity. But I resolved the issue by upgrading the forwarder from 6.2.5 to 7.0.2. And on indexers I have 7.2.1. &lt;/P&gt;
